#284901 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#284901 is composed of 15.7% red, 28.6%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.6% yellow and 71.4% black. It has a hue angle of 87.5 degrees, a saturation of 97.3% and a lightness of 14.5%. #284901 color hex could be obtained by blending #509202 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

#284901 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#284901 has RGB values of R:40, G:73,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0.71. Its decimal value is 2640129.

Shades and Tints of #284901
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080f00 is the darkest color, while #fdfff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#284901
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#252723 is the less saturated color, while #284901 is the most saturated one.
